Croatian Prime Minister Andrej Plenkovic called the Monday protest in Sarajevo against High Representative Christian Schmidt’s alleged plans to impose changes to Election Law “awful and unacceptable” and “evidence the country needed the Peljesac bridge."

Speaking in Dubrovnik Tuesday on the occasion of the opening of the Peljesac Bridge, Plenkovic said that the Sarajevo protest against Christian Schmidt's announced measures related to amendments to the Election Law and certain constitutional changes in the Federation of BiH entity, was “awful and unacceptable, and even threatening with protests to the High Representative Christian Schmidt shows that this bridge is not a luxury for Croatia, it is a necessity.”

According to the Prime Minister, the Peljesac Bridge is the embodiment of what Croatia is today, compared to what it wanted to be before.

“We’re pursuing strategic national interests with a strong international position and full confidence and vision in what we do,” Plenkovic said.
